Abstract
In this oral history, Laura Landry is joined by John Bell, President and CEO of Tampa Theatre, who shares the maturation of the establishment during his time. Bell describes the changes over the years to previewing films, live shows, and ongoing renovations to preserve the historical authenticity of the building. John Bell spotlights the profound relationship between the local community and Tampa Theatre. He fondly describes moments when the community rallied to save the theater in the sixties and their unwavering support of the theater during the COVID-19 pandemic.
